Transaction 553b6041abecd50e32c1e675ff87fdd8c824e4e48496e69d4fcebd80c823c88e
1 Input
1 Outputs
- 553b6041abecd50e32c1e675ff87fdd8c824e4e48496e69d4fcebd80c823c88e:0
value 735911
address 18JhzvKnSjTU611Yyit14FFx5Snb8CFmsZ